> In current implementation the path of device XS entry is created with
> string from libxl__device_kind enum. But access to the device entry
> usually done with hardcoded path. This is source of potential errors.
> This patchset changes hardcoded device name in the XS path to string
> representation of libxl__device_kind enum. Also it changes "type" field
> in libxl__..._devtype structure to keep libxl__device_kind. It allows
> to move some duplicated functions to macros.
